In a nutshell

At Virgin Atlantic, we're passionate about using data to make smarter decisions and create experiences that truly stand out. As a PRM Insights and Development Analyst, you'll be at the forefront of developing and implementing automated solutions and analytics capabilities within our Pricing and Revenue Management team. Your work will help us streamline processes, unlock insights, and deliver commercial strategies that keep us ahead of the curve.

This is a fantastic opportunity for someone who loves solving complex problems and turning raw data into actionable intelligence. You'll design innovative solutions, build automation tools, and create dashboards that empower the business to make informed decisions.

Day to day

* Understand briefs, clarify objectives, and create detailed solutions aligned with business goals.
* Develop and maintain solutions that simplify data processing and reporting workflows.
* Design dashboards and models that enable self-service analytics and continuous performance monitoring.
* Extract, clean, and validate data from multiple sources to guarantee accuracy and consistency.
* Work closely with stakeholders to understand requirements and communicate findings clearly to non-technical audiences.
* Keep up to date with the latest tools, technologies, and best practices, proactively improving processes and developing your technical skills.

About You

Are you a creative problem solver with a passion for data and automation? Do you love turning complexity into clarity? We're looking for someone who can combine technical expertise with commercial understanding and thrives on delivering solutions that make a difference.

In addition to the above, we'd love for you to demonstrate the following:

* Demonstrated planning skills and ability to structure problems effectively.
* Analytical mindset with the ability to anticipate issues and act proactively.
* Proven experience in collaborating with stakeholders to support multiple functions.
* Proven experience managing priorities and de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
* Proficiency in data programming and data science techniques (SQL, Python, Databricks).
* Skilled in data visualisation and MS Power Platform tools (PowerBI, Tableau, Power Automate, Power Apps).
